## Configuration

Plugin authors extending the Tickover drift investigator should note that all scheduler probes read their settings from the shared env file, not from plugin manifests. Timing thresholds (DRIFT_WINDOW_MS, PROBE_CADENCE) may be overridden per plugin, but the collector credential may not. That credential, which your plugin inherits automatically at load time, is defined on the following line.

vault entry, bagep-yahip: VAULT_KEY8=d2a227e5

Subject: Quickstore 4.2 — bloom filter now fronts the KV layer

Plugin authors: starting with this release, Quickstore places a bloom filter ahead of the key-value store. Negative lookups return faster; false positives fall through safely. No API changes are required on your side. Verify your plugin against the staging build referenced below.

session token of fahif-tadup = htk3_9c7

Subject: Dedup cut-over complete

Hi all — the Harborline customer-record deduplication cut-over finished last night. Merged records now resolve to a single canonical ID, and the legacy lookup endpoint returns redirects until it is retired next quarter. Plugin authors should update match-handling logic accordingly. The post-cut-over service settings your plugins will run against are shown below.

config for bagep-kageg:
ULADOR_LOG_LEVEL=warn
ULADOR_METRICS_HOST=metrics.ulador.tolvaqcorp.corp
ULADOR_POOL_SIZE=32

## Approvals — Gaugewright Metrics Sidecar

Release manager: all Gaugewright sidecar releases need two approvals. Automated: conformance suite green, cardinality regression under 2%. Manual: one sign-off from the observability group. Hotfixes skip the cardinality gate but require a post-release audit within 48h. No exceptions for config-only changes; they ship through the same pipeline. Final sign-off on every release, including hotfixes, comes from:

signatory, bajof-yahif: Zorael Wenael